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

******ская версия по умолчанию и SeoPro


Papai
 Поделиться

Рекомендованные сообщения

Добрый день!

У меня стоит ocStore 3.0.2.0 со встроенным SeoPro.

Сейчас хочу сделать чтобы ******ский язык был по умолчанию.

В настройках показывает что ******ский стоит по умолчанию, а показывает все-равно русский.

Разобрался, что когда отключаешь SeoPro то ******ская версия становится по умолчанию и все работает.

Но как сделать чтобы и SeoPro работал и версия по умолчанию была ******ская?

Уточняю все делал на чистом дистрибутиве, не используя ни одного модуля кроме установки ******ского.

Помогите в решении вопроса.

Благодарю!

Ссылка на комментарий
Поделиться на других сайтах


Тоже сегодня занимался этим вопросом - ничего не помогало. Но после Вашего вопроса мысль одна появилась, я ее реализовал и вроде все работает. Не знаю правильно или нет, но пока работает.

 

Нужно через базу данных зайти в таблицу seo_url, найти запись common/home и зайдя в редактирование в поле language id установить id ******ского.

 

Почему через базу, потому что через админку не даст это сделать (Дизайн-Сео Урл)

 

Это решение при включенном SEO PRO

  • +1 2
Ссылка на комментарий
Поделиться на других сайтах


 pivosrakami Благодарю за Ваше решение, обязательно попробую на следующем проекте!

Уже поставил модуль мультиязык и вопрос для этого проекта закрылся )

Может за это время еще кто-то воспользуется вашим решением - дайте обратную связь!

Опенкарт бесплатный софт и подразумевает решения вопросов без денег )

Всем хорошего дня!

Ссылка на комментарий
Поделиться на других сайтах


  • 3 месяца спустя...
В 28.01.2021 в 21:33, pivosrakami сказал:

Почему через базу, потому что через админку не даст это сделать (Дизайн-Сео Урл)

Может кому пригодится.
Нужно в файле admin/controller/design/seo_url.php найти

if (!$this->request->post['keyword'])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

и заменить на
 

if (!$this->request->post['keyword'] && ($this->request->post['query'] != 'common/home'))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

 

Тогда язык для "common/home" можно менять из админки.

  • +1 3
Ссылка на комментарий
Поделиться на других сайтах

  • 1 год спустя...
В 22.05.2021 в 14:27, Bazilio сказав:

Может кому пригодится.
Нужно в файле admin/controller/design/seo_url.php найти

if (!$this->request->post['keyword'])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

и заменить на
 

if (!$this->request->post['keyword'] && ($this->request->post['query'] != 'common/home'))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

 

Тогда язык для "common/home" можно менять из админки.

 

В 22.05.2021 в 14:27, Bazilio сказав:

Может кому пригодится.
Нужно в файле admin/controller/design/seo_url.php найти

if (!$this->request->post['keyword'])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

и заменить на
 

if (!$this->request->post['keyword'] && ($this->request->post['query'] != 'common/home')) {
	$this->error['keyword'] = $this->language->get('error_keyword');
}

 

Тогда язык для "common/home" можно менять из админки.

А что делать, если в моем файле нет такого текста? Второй  день читаю статти и так  и не могу язык поменять (не програмист)

Ссылка на комментарий
Поделиться на других сайтах


28.06.2022 в 23:57, LuBaKa сказал:

А что делать, если

 

28.06.2022 в 23:57, LuBaKa сказал:

не програмист

 

Либо разбираться, либо в раздел платных услуг. Так же есть модули, которые и не программист может поставить.

Ссылка на комментарий
Поделиться на других сайтах

  • 3 недели спустя...

А что значит язык по умолчанию? 

Ведь если с google поиска переходишь на сайт, где ссылка имеет такой вид (site.ua/tovar) а укр ссылка (site.ua/tovar_ua) - ты же все равно попадёшь на Рус версию сайта.

 

Или как проверить что у тебя укр версия по умолчанию? 

 

Мне интересно за что будут штрафовать по новому закону?

Ссылка на комментарий
Поделиться на других сайтах


В 14.07.2022 в 10:43, Nannco сказав:

А что значит язык по умолчанию? 

Ведь если с google поиска переходишь на сайт, где ссылка имеет такой вид (site.ua/tovar) а укр ссылка (site.ua/tovar_ua) - ты же все равно попадёшь на Рус версию сайта.

 

Или как проверить что у тебя укр версия по умолчанию? 

 

Мне интересно за что будут штрафовать по новому закону?

Все можна налаштувати згідно закону України, навіть якщо посилання в пошуковій системі ру - завантажиться сторінка українська, якщо користувач зайшов перший раз

Ссылка на комментарий
Поделиться на других сайтах

14.07.2022 в 10:50, markimax сказал:

Все можна налаштувати згідно закону України, навіть якщо посилання в пошуковій системі ру - завантажиться сторінка українська, якщо користувач зайшов перший раз

Да только что протестировал, а есть уже готовое решение или нет?

 

Я тоже в Настройках - Локализация - (выставил язык Укр)

Но когда захожу через Инкогнито, загружается Русская версия сайта, попробовал то что написал  LuBaKa - не помогла :(

Ссылка на комментарий
Поделиться на других сайтах


14.07.2022 в 11:01, Nannco сказал:

попробовал то что написал  LuBaKa - не помогла :(

@markimax Напишите лучше он поможет сделать как надо

Изменено пользователем magdek
Ссылка на комментарий
Поделиться на других сайтах


14.07.2022 в 10:50, markimax сказал:

Все можна налаштувати згідно закону України, навіть якщо посилання в пошуковій системі ру - завантажиться сторінка українська, якщо користувач зайшов перший раз

Доброго дня. 

Підскажіть це у вас можна придбати такий модуль, чи це виключно ваше допрацювання кода ? 

Ссылка на комментарий
Поделиться на других сайтах


16.07.2022 в 15:57, Sokolov39 сказал:

Доброго дня. 

Підскажіть це у вас можна придбати такий модуль, чи це виключно ваше допрацювання кода ? 

Можно, покупайте с установкой.

Ссылка на комментарий
Поделиться на других сайтах

16.07.2022 в 17:55, buslikdrev сказал:

Можно, покупайте с установкой.

Можна посилання на модуль щоб купити? 

Изменено пользователем Sokolov39
Ссылка на комментарий
Поделиться на других сайтах


16.07.2022 в 19:03, magdek сказал:

 

Дякую ,   але для  мультиязичності я використовую ось цей модуль   - тому в такому випадку як бути? 

 

Изменено пользователем Sokolov39
Ссылка на комментарий
Поделиться на других сайтах


16.07.2022 в 22:40, Sokolov39 сказал:

Дякую ,   але для  мультизичності я використовую ось цей модуль   - тому в такому випадку як бути? 

Як мініму звернутися до автора

Ссылка на комментарий
Поделиться на других сайтах


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
 Подел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.